Output 86501aa79244d6fe041187646279ad32a78640d58368b0c48af2c0dbcb47ff21:1

value
41903
script pubkey
OP_0 OP_PUSHBYTES_20 ae4ec23f6e4610111dea5d7eb0e8a642de4acbaf
address
bc1q4e8vy0mwgcgpz802t4ltp69xgt0y4ja0vyu595
transaction
86501aa79244d6fe041187646279ad32a78640d58368b0c48af2c0dbcb47ff21
confirmations
318065
spent
true